Commit Graph

30404 Commits

Author SHA1 Message Date
michael dupuis
905a17c3e5 Fixed instancing not taking into account instance scale while calculating LOD, it could result in having large instance clipped. Tested using LOD Ditherering and normal one.
Remove part of the previous tentative fixed i had made a few months ago.

#jira UE-59256
#rb none
[CODEREVIEW] Jack.Porter, Jeremy.Moore

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: michael.dupuis
#ROBOMERGE-SOURCE: CL 5224628 in //UE4/Release-4.22/... via CL 5225334
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5245009 by michael dupuis in Dev-Networking branch]
2019-02-28 17:08:26 -05:00
jonas meyer
c97a30f704 Fix for vulkan hdr video export crashing.
Fix vulkan validation error when exporting videos. Window swap chain was smaller than rendertarget, and a copy was writing out of bounds on the swap chain.
#jira UE-70118
#rb none
[FYI] rolando.caloca

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: jonas.meyer
#ROBOMERGE-SOURCE: CL 5224478 in //UE4/Release-4.22/... via CL 5225322
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5245000 by jonas meyer in Dev-Networking branch]
2019-02-28 17:08:24 -05:00
dmitriy dyomin
00d50c3422 Separate supported flags for images and buffers in Vulkan. This should fix VK crashes on Note9.
#jira UE-70666
#rb rolando.caloca

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: dmitriy.dyomin
#ROBOMERGE-SOURCE: CL 5224013 in //UE4/Release-4.22/... via CL 5225313
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244993 by dmitriy dyomin in Dev-Networking branch]
2019-02-28 17:08:22 -05:00
arciel rekman
29322b5e0c Linux: make LoginId (aka old MachineId) easier to parse (UE-70622).
- Amendment to UE-70622.

#rb none
#jira UE-70622

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: arciel.rekman
#ROBOMERGE-SOURCE: CL 5223673 in //UE4/Release-4.22/... via CL 5225299
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244984 by arciel rekman in Dev-Networking branch]
2019-02-28 17:08:16 -05:00
marcin undak
0bc7478fe6 Linux: Improved FPlatformMisc::GetLoginId()
#rb arciel.rekman
[FYI] arciel.rekman
#jira UE-70622

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: marcin.undak
#ROBOMERGE-SOURCE: CL 5215697 in //UE4/Release-4.22/... via CL 5225290
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244975 by marcin undak in Dev-Networking branch]
2019-02-28 17:08:13 -05:00
ben marsh
a3ebb7cc2c Add a better error message when trying to use a module that is not included in an installed build.
#rb none
#jira

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: ben.marsh
#ROBOMERGE-SOURCE: CL 5215521 in //UE4/Release-4.22/... via CL 5225284
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244970 by ben marsh in Dev-Networking branch]
2019-02-28 17:08:11 -05:00
ryan vance
6adebea853 Updates for Google's VR licensing agreements.
#rb tps
#jira 0

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: ryan.vance
#ROBOMERGE-SOURCE: CL 5206320 in //UE4/Release-4.22/... via CL 5225249
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244932 by ryan vance in Dev-Networking branch]
2019-02-28 17:07:52 -05:00
lauren ridge
7d3bf92d10 Adding code to close all editor widget tabs if we are closing all editors
#jira none
#rb Nick.Darnell

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: lauren.ridge
#ROBOMERGE-SOURCE: CL 5206247 in //UE4/Release-4.22/... via CL 5225240
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244931 by lauren ridge in Dev-Networking branch]
2019-02-28 17:07:50 -05:00
jason stasik
6fe508ae17 Prevent dragging a widget while already dragging one
#jira UE-69317
#rb chris.gagnon

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: jason.stasik
#ROBOMERGE-SOURCE: CL 5206155 in //UE4/Release-4.22/... via CL 5225233
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244930 by jason stasik in Dev-Networking branch]
2019-02-28 17:07:49 -05:00
david hibbitts
efa388d017 SceneCaptureComponent now responds to OnVisibilityChanged events and sets the ProxyMesh Visibility to match the component's visibility
This is a resubmission of 5146216 with the ProxyMeshComponent modification correctly guarded by #if WITH_EDITORONLY_DATA

#jira UE-70407
#rb none

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: david.hibbitts
#ROBOMERGE-SOURCE: CL 5206079 in //UE4/Release-4.22/... via CL 5225227
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244919 by david hibbitts in Dev-Networking branch]
2019-02-28 17:07:47 -05:00
jules blok
da85559073 Support ISR in distortion rendering
#jira UE-70276
#rb Ryan.Vance

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: jules.blok
#ROBOMERGE-SOURCE: CL 5205808 in //UE4/Release-4.22/... via CL 5225219
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244909 by jules blok in Dev-Networking branch]
2019-02-28 17:07:43 -05:00
julien stjean
2c44a0d04a Fixed "Mesh Editing" toolbar in Static Mesh Editor showing as "Secondary Toolbar" when closing and re-opening the tab.
#jira UE-70173
#rb Anousack.Kitisa

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: julien.stjean
#ROBOMERGE-SOURCE: CL 5205456 in //UE4/Release-4.22/... via CL 5225202
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244876 by julien stjean in Dev-Networking branch]
2019-02-28 17:07:36 -05:00
helge mathee
6ef408cf5b Merging using Dev-Anim<->Release-4.22
Original CL 5202790
#jira UE-67687
#rb Lina.Halper

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: helge.mathee
#ROBOMERGE-SOURCE: CL 5203042 in //UE4/Release-4.22/... via CL 5225185
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244840 by helge mathee in Dev-Networking branch]
2019-02-28 17:07:29 -05:00
helge mathee
52084e6c5a Merging using Dev-Anim<->Release-4.22
Original CL 5117200
#jira UE-67687
#rb Lina.Halper

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: helge.mathee
#ROBOMERGE-SOURCE: CL 5203041 in //UE4/Release-4.22/... via CL 5225182
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244837 by helge mathee in Dev-Networking branch]
2019-02-28 17:07:27 -05:00
michael trepka
08c7f258c5 Use FMath::CeilToInt when calculating the resized Mac window width and height to make sure the window size matches its viewport size after changes to SlateRHIRenderer in CL 4969188
#jira UE-70612
#rb none

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: michael.trepka
#ROBOMERGE-SOURCE: CL 5202383 in //UE4/Release-4.22/... via CL 5225175
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244834 by michael trepka in Dev-Networking branch]
2019-02-28 17:07:22 -05:00
michael trepka
d9efd168dc Avoid infinite recursive calls in FMacApplication::CloseQueuedWindows()
#jira UE-51711
#rb Richard.Wallis

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: michael.trepka
#ROBOMERGE-SOURCE: CL 5200920 in //UE4/Release-4.22/... via CL 5225171
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244822 by michael trepka in Dev-Networking branch]
2019-02-28 17:07:16 -05:00
projectgheist
8c07930c9f Enable small icons for Preview modes (Contributed by projectgheist)
#5577
#jira UE-70558
#rb Jack.Porter

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: jack.porter
#ROBOMERGE-SOURCE: CL 5199410 in //UE4/Release-4.22/... via CL 5225170
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244819 by jack porter in Dev-Networking branch]
2019-02-28 17:07:15 -05:00
marc audy
2232d553f3 PR #5546: UE-69951: World nullptr check in CheckForErrors (Contributed by projectgheist)
#jira UE-69951
#jira UE-69972
#rb Me

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: marc.audy
#ROBOMERGE-SOURCE: CL 5198851 in //UE4/Release-4.22/... via CL 5225169
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244815 by marc audy in Dev-Networking branch]
2019-02-28 17:07:13 -05:00
dan oconnor
f6dd4e320b Undo //UE4/Release-4.22/Engine/Source/Runtime/Engine/Private/... changelist 5178602
#rb None
#jira UE-70072

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: dan.oconnor
#ROBOMERGE-SOURCE: CL 5189067 in //UE4/Release-4.22/... via CL 5225163
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244784 by dan oconnor in Dev-Networking branch]
2019-02-28 17:07:02 -05:00
lauren ridge
7e739a21fb Fix for editor utility widgets staying in the windows menu after close
#jira UE-70562
#rb minor

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: lauren.ridge
#ROBOMERGE-SOURCE: CL 5188955 in //UE4/Release-4.22/... via CL 5225162
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244778 by lauren ridge in Dev-Networking branch]
2019-02-28 17:07:00 -05:00
robert manuszewski
c5fcebe67a Fixing incremental build compile errors introduced in CL #5223889
#rb none
#jira UE-70640

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: robert.manuszewski
#ROBOMERGE-SOURCE: CL 5223925 in //UE4/Main/...
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244770 by robert manuszewski in Dev-Networking branch]
2019-02-28 17:06:58 -05:00
robert manuszewski
2ef9da4d12 DuplicatedDataReader and DuplicatedDataWriter will now store UObject serialize context internally so that they don't crash in case of an error
#rb none
#jira UE-70144

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: robert.manuszewski
#ROBOMERGE-SOURCE: CL 5223889 in //UE4/Main/...
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5244762 by robert manuszewski in Dev-Networking branch]
2019-02-28 17:06:56 -05:00
daniel wright
d79eae2b21 Landscape thumbnails need to compile velocity shaders
#rb none
#jira UE-70569

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: daniel.wright
#ROBOMERGE-SOURCE: CL 5185266 in //UE4/Release-4.22/... via CL 5207764
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5235390 by daniel wright in Dev-Networking branch]
2019-02-27 18:57:53 -05:00
jeanluc corenthin
f266ca00f9 Fixed logic issue in SaveExistingStaticMeshData
#jira UE-66896
#rb alexis.matte

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: jeanluc.corenthin
#ROBOMERGE-SOURCE: CL 5184871 in //UE4/Release-4.22/... via CL 5207760
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5235389 by jeanluc corenthin in Dev-Networking branch]
2019-02-27 18:57:51 -05:00
dan oconnor
c27c343602 Updated assert in PRIVATE_PatchNewObjectIntoExport in light of stricter CurrentLoadContext, fixes crash when compiling blueprints in preview releases
#rb Robert.Manuszewski
#jira UE-70513, UE-70486

#ROBOMERGE-OWNER: ryan.gerleve
#ROBOMERGE-AUTHOR: dan.oconnor
#ROBOMERGE-SOURCE: CL 5182968 in //UE4/Release-4.22/... via CL 5207737
#ROBOMERGE-BOT: ENGINE (Main -> Dev-Networking)

[CL 5235386 by dan oconnor in Dev-Networking branch]
2019-02-27 18:57:38 -05:00